Delving into the Lyrics: Decoding the Meaning of 'Waton'

Alright, let's get into the heart of the matter – the lyrics. What exactly is "Waton" about? The song's title, which translates roughly to "just" or "only," hints at the song's central theme: a love that's perhaps incomplete or unfulfilled. It explores the feeling of loving someone in a way that might not be fully reciprocated.

The lyrics are filled with vivid imagery and emotional depth. They capture the bittersweet nature of love. The song portrays the protagonist's feelings of longing, acceptance, and a willingness to love despite the challenges. Denny Caknan is an Indonesian singer and songwriter who has rapidly become one of the most popular artists in the country. He has amassed a huge fanbase with his unique blend of music, relatable lyrics, and genuine personality. His journey to the top of the music charts is a testament to his talent and hard work.

Denny Caknan's musical style is distinctive, blending traditional Javanese music with elements of pop and dangdut. This fusion creates a sound that appeals to a wide audience and distinguishes him from other artists in the Indonesian music scene. His decision to blend genres has not only defined his music but has also created a sound that speaks to a variety of listeners.
